This role will be based at our clients site in Wolverhampton.What will I be responsible forJoining our team as a Calibration Engineer, you will be responsible for the calibration of gauging and all peripheral tasks associated with running a small calibration laboratory. The goal is to ensure that equipment is calibrated to meet the customers KPI and turnaround time requirements. Your daily tasks will include:

  • To calibrate a range of dimensional measurement equipment such as micrometers (internal, external, depth and bore), plug and pin gauges, feeler gauges, lever and plunger dial gauges, radius and screw plug gauges and plain setting rings.
  • To additionally calibrate pressure gauges, temperature controllers and process ovens.
  • Be able to use the following calibration laboratory standard equipment, Universal Length Machine (ULM), gauge blocks, surface tables, height gauges, deadweight testers, thermocouples and multi-meter.
  • Manage the entire calibration process from start to finish to meet customer expectations.
  • Use various metrology software processes to take measurements and record data.
  • Prepare product reports, documentation and certification.
  • Create work instructions/procedures, risk assessments and method statements.
  • Work with the customer Quality Department to ensure all metrological processes are correctly recorded.
  • Take part in customer and external Quality audits as the calibration department representative.
  • To follow customer and Trescal QHS&E regulations as they apply.
